PRAISING GOD IN SONG

Whenever we sing "Amazing Grace"
Or sing of "The Old Rugged Cross"
And "Stand Up, Stand Up For Jesus"
"I Am Thine, O Lord", I am no longer lost

"I Love To Tell The Story" 
"Leaning On The Everlasting Arms"
"To God Be The Glory" and
"Standing On The Promises" I feel no alarm

"When The Roll Is Called Up Yonder"
And "When We All Get To Heaven"
"We'll Nevermore Have To Wonder"
Because on earth we were forgiven

"A Mighty Fortress Is Our God"
"His Grace Is Greater Than All Our Sins"
It'll be "Shoutin' Time" in Heaven 
Where Joy Shall Never End

"Christ The Lord Is Risen Today"
"Are you Washed In The Blood"
"Softly And Tenderly, Jesus Is Calling"
"Blessed Be The Name Of The Lord"
